前言:在CTF中可以说是经常碰到md5加密了,一般都是进行强比较抑或是弱比较,考法非常多,但是万变不离其中。只要我们掌握了原理,一切问题便迎刃而解了。文章首发于 我的博客 ,格式可能比较清晰,有兴趣了解CTF中MD5碰撞的伙伴可以移步查看简单了解MD5:md5是一种加密算法,并且不能防止碰撞破解。md5加密是不可逆的,这就意味着有两串不同的字符串加密出来的内容却是相同的加密过程简单,碰撞还原字符难PHP的弱比较:先提两个例子:var_dump("123a"==123)var_dump("123a"=="123")在没有认真总结前,完全不知道弱比较还要区分与字符串类型比较还是与int类型比较上述
我搜索了上述主题并找到了各种答案,但没有帮助我每当我从nyweb表单上发布日期时,我表上的结果总是0000-00-00我已经在这里待了2天,并尝试了我发现的所有建议,但无济于事。我确定我遗漏了一个非常小的细节。这是我的代码:IBADAMBMs$(function(){$("#datepicker").datepicker({dateFormat:'yy-mm-dd'});});LogoutDIVISION"method="post">Branch:DIVINEGLORY1GLORY2Date:Amount:0){die("Doubletreatmentnotallowed");}els
InregistrationformofmywebapplicationIhaveapasswordfield.NowwhenIaminsertingthedatainthedatabaseonthesubmitbutton.方法一:我使用md5函数生成它的哈希值,然后将加密数据保存到数据库中。方法二:我使用MySql中的查询直接将特定列的数据转换成哈希值。Whichapproachhaslessoverheadandwhichoneismoresecureacrossthenetwork.Pleasehelp?使用的数据库:MySql5,前端:Java 最
安卓公钥和md5证书签名大家好,最近需要备案app,用到了公钥和md5,MD5签名我倒是知道,然而对于公钥却一下子不知道了,现在我讲一下我的流程。首先是md5证书签名的查看,生成了apk和签名.jks后,就是查看Md5了,如下如输入密码后,敲击回车键,就会生成md5和sha1的数据,对于md5签名,需要去掉冒号和都改为小写才行;以上是如何获取md5签名,下面再来讲解如何获取公钥,:1,使用之前打包的apk文件,修改后缀名为.zip,然后解压2,会发现有一个META-INF文件,打开后,里面有个CERT.RSA,修改后缀名为.p7b后,然后双击打开3,会出现一个弹出框,点击左侧的逻辑存储名->对
我正在运行我在谷歌搜索时找到的示例代码:SELECTMD5(RAND())但是,令我惊讶的是,MD5返回的是普通数字,而不是十六进制数字。使用CONV(MD5(RAND()),10,16)似乎可以解决我的问题,但MySQL文档指出MD5函数应该返回一个已经为十六进制的字符串。我做错了什么吗?EDIT2:这个问题似乎只存在于phpMyAdmin,而不是MySQL的命令行版本。编辑:我的MySQL版本:mysql--versionmysqlVer14.14Distrib5.1.41,fordebian-linux-gnu(x86_64)usingreadline6.1MD5值示例:6338
我正在尝试使用php将md5哈希插入到mysql数据库表中。$key=$email.date('mY');$key=md5($key);$query="INSERTINTOconfirm(key,angemeldet_von,geschlecht,geburtstag)VALUES('$key','$angemeldet_von','$geschlecht','$geburtstag')";$confirm=mysql_query($query,$connectionID)ordie('failedconnecting:'.mysql_error());此查询返回错误:failedco
参考:填写App特征信息_备案-阿里云帮助中心安卓应用获取App特征信息指导包名、公钥和签名MD5获取方式有多种,本文以使用JadxGUI工具获取为例。下载JadxGUI工具:GitHub-skylot/jadx:DextoJavadecompiler下载安装完成后,使用此工具打开apk包。公钥与签名MD5值获取:查找文件APKsignature中模数(公钥)和MD5签名。
出于安全目的,我以这种方式进行一些查询:SELECTavatar_dataFROMusersWHEREMD5(ID)='md5value'所以,例如我有这个条目:-TABLE.users-ID|avatar_data39|some-data我做这个查询:SELECTavatar_dataFROMusersWHEREMD5(ID)='d67d8ab4f4c10bf22aa353e27879133c''d67d8ab4f4c10bf22aa353e27879133c'是MD5过滤后的'39'值。我有一个非常大的数据库,里面有很多条目。我想知道这种方法是否会损害数据库性能?
我在c#中有一个带有sqlite的UWP应用程序。我遇到的问题是datePicker,当DateTimeOffSetTimeConverter给我一个例外时,如果我删除日期01/01/1001(将其删除正确的日期),则日期点的日期在另一个页面中,称为mypetpage。c#privateasyncvoidaddbutton_click(对象发送者,routedeventargse){varselectedDate=Data1.Date.ToString();DataBaseHelperDb_Pet=newDataBaseHelper();if(txtnombre.Text!=""&txtchi
如何从数据库中获取日期值到html日期选择器?以下是我的html代码。startdate?>name="date"min=""/>在数据库中,日期字段的数据类型是“日期”。只是我想从mysql检索日期到html5datepicker 最佳答案 startdate));?>"name="date"/> 关于php-如何从数据库中获取日期到htmldatepicker,我们在StackOverflow上找到一个类似的问题: https://stackoverflo